## Data Stores: Autocomplete Index

Welcome aboard. The Quillbrook autocomplete index lives in a dedicated search cluster, separate from the main catalog database. It has been slow since the Tindermere launch because prefix queries bypass the trigram cache; a rebuild is scheduled but not yet prioritized. As a contractor, please test queries against staging only, and keep result limits under 50 to avoid timeouts. Warm-up scripts live in the tools repo. For staging access, the cluster accepts connections via the string below.

replica DSN, haweg-fajog: cockroachdb://silael_svc:onzs1oy@db-61f1.ordincloud.internal:5432/ulaath

## Releases

Every release of the Centavo conversion library must pass the rounding regression suite before tagging. Support team: most customer tickets about off-by-one-cent totals trace back to mixing banker's rounding with truncation in downstream reports, not to the library itself, so check the caller's settings first. Release candidates are cut from the stable branch, versioned semantically, and published to the internal registry only after the artifact has been signed with the key shown below.

release key, fahaf-bajof: bky3_Xam

Notes from the Parcelforge retro, Thursday. The shipping-fee rules engine is getting hairy — we've got 212 rules now and nobody remembers why half the island surcharges exist. Agreed: every new rule needs a comment with a reason and an expiry review date. The DSL docs are in the wiki, honestly pretty decent. If you're maintaining this later and something smells off, ping the person responsible, named below.

named custodian: Brivan Eliath Quenox Frador

Runbook fragment — Coilworth queue-depth autoscaler. Before approving changes to the scaling policy, confirm the reviewer has checked three invariants: scale-up triggers when depth exceeds the high-water mark for two consecutive polls, scale-down waits out the full cooldown window, and replica counts never drop below the floor defined in the tenant profile. Any deviation must be justified in the review notes. Verification should be performed against the canary deployment identified by the token below.

session token of tajef-bageg = htk21_5d90d574934f3ccae6437